The Crane Frolics Qi Gong is one set of exercises from a larger Qi Gong system call The Five Animal Frolics Qi Gong which were developed around 200AD. The Crane Exercises mimic the way a bird moves its wings and stands on one leg. The movements are flowing and graceful. The Crane Exercises belong to the Fire Element and help to strengthen the Heart, Lungs, and Circulation. This book is an ethnographic study of the martial art of taijiquan (or 'tai chi') as it is practiced in China and the United States. Drawing on recent literature on ethnicity, critical race theory, the phenomenology of race, and globalization, the author discusses identity in terms of sensual experience and the transmission/receipt of knowledge.
